STEVE POOL
About the artist:
Born in Brooklyn, gifted photographer Steve Pool lives and works on the Upper West Side in New York City. He has a broad range of photography interests—culture, still lifes, portraits, travel and food. He has provided photography for a number of cookbooks and often works with his wife, cook book author Judith Choate, on their own projects, as well as photographing and styling the food of chefs and culinary personalities. Steve describes his own artistic trajectory as follows:
I got my first camera at about 8 years old. From that moment on, there have been several periods alternating between making pictures and taking none at all. I spent part of my service years in Japan where I bought a Nikon and began to photograph with a measure of serious intent. Once I returned to the States, the inspiration of the Harlem Renaissance moved me forward until “real” life intruded. But, in the summer of 2002 my wife, against all protest, bought me a camera for our trip to Sicily. The photographs of food that I took there were used for a book. I have not put the camera down since.
I have no formal photography training, but have been fortunate for the guidance and rigor of the graphic and book designer, Joel Avirom, and of Michael Tolani, who has printed all of my work, including the photographs for this show. Both Joel and Michael are ‘with me’ each time I press the shutter release.
